From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1758974AbZCMQyE (ORCPT ); Fri, 13 Mar 2009 12:54:04 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1754903AbZCMQxw (ORCPT ); Fri, 13 Mar 2009 12:53:52 -0400 Received: from ogre.sisk.pl ([217.79.144.158]:37689 "EHLO ogre.sisk.pl"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754180AbZCMQxv convert rfc822-to-8bit (ORCPT ); Fri, 13 Mar 2009 12:53:51 -0400 From: "Rafael J. Wysocki" To: Arve =?iso-8859-1?q?Hj=F8nnev=E5g?= Subject: Re: [update, rev. 6] Re: [PATCH 1/10] PM: Rework handling of interrupts during suspend-resume (rev. 5) Date: Fri, 13 Mar 2009 17:53:37 +0100 User-Agent: KMail/1.11.1 (Linux/2.6.29-rc7-tst; KDE/4.2.1; x86_64; ; ) Cc: Thomas Gleixner , Ingo Molnar , pm list , LKML , Linus Torvalds , "Eric W. Biederman" , Benjamin Herrenschmidt , Jeremy Fitzhardinge , Len Brown , Jesse Barnes , Frans Pop References: <200902221837.49396.rjw@sisk.pl> <200903122243.27452.rjw@sisk.pl> In-Reply-To: MIME-Version: 1.0 Content-Type: text/plain; charset="iso-8859-1" Content-Transfer-Encoding: 8BIT Content-Disposition: inline Message-Id: <200903131753.39076.rjw@sisk.pl>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Friday 13 March 2009, Arve Hjønnevåg wrote: > On Thu, Mar 12, 2009 at 1:43 PM, Rafael J. Wysocki wrote: > > > > +void __disable_irq(struct irq_desc *desc, unsigned int irq, bool suspend) > > +{ > > + if (suspend) { > > + if (desc->action && (desc->action->flags & IRQF_TIMER)) > > + return; > > Don't you want "(!desc->action || ..." here to avoid enabling unused > interrupts on resume? Hmm, good idea, thanks. Best, Rafael